Jellyfish Costume
Unleash your creativity and transform into a mesmerizing jellyfish this Halloween with our easy-to-follow DIY jellyfish costume tutorial. This unique and eye-catching costume is perfect for those looking to stand out with an innovative design. Let’s dive into the materials needed and the step-by-step instructions to create your very own jellyfish costume at home.
Materials Needed
- 5 yards of purple glow-in-the-dark tulle
- 1 yard of 1″ purple elastic (or 2″ sewn narrower)
- 4 yards of chiffon flower trim
- LED purple light strip
- Rotary cutter and acrylic quilt ruler
- 1 package of wired purple ribbon
- 1 package of ruffled purple ribbon
- Scissors, thread, hand sewing needle, and a lighter (optional)
Step-by-Step Instructions
To create your stunning DIY jellyfish costume, follow these easy steps:
- Cut the tulle strips, 36″ long and 5″ wide, using the rotary cutter and acrylic ruler.
- Weave the tulle strips under the umbrella spokes, securing them with hot glue.
- Attach the chiffon flower trim by hand-sewing it spaced around the skirt and on the arm seams of the leotard.
- Incorporate the LED purple light strip into the costume for a mesmerizing glow-in-the-dark effect.
- Use the wired and ruffled purple ribbons to add extra texture and dimension to your jellyfish tentacles.
- Adjust the elastic waistband to fit your measurements, ensuring a comfortable and secure fit.

Pencil Costume
For a classic and easy-to-make DIY Halloween costume, consider transforming yourself into a giant pencil. This pencil costume is a simple yet effective option that requires minimal effort but makes a big impact.
The key components you’ll need for the pencil costume include a yellow dress or top and bottom, a large piece of white poster board, and black and yellow paint. Start by painting the poster board to resemble a giant pencil, complete with a sharpened tip and distinctive markings. Wear the yellow outfit to complete the look, and you’re ready to stand out at any Halloween party or trick-or-treating adventure.
One clever addition to the diy pencil costume is incorporating a candy holder. You can create a pencil-shaped container or sharpener from a cardboard box and attach it to the costume, allowing you to collect treats hands-free throughout the night. This not only adds a practical element but also enhances the overall cohesiveness of the costume.

M&M Candy Costume
One of the simplest and most popular DIY Halloween costumes is the classic M&M candy costume. With just a few basic supplies, you can create a fun and colorful outfit that’s perfect for both kids and adults. Whether you’re looking for a last-minute costume idea or want to get creative with your Halloween attire, the m&m candy costume is a great option.
Supplies Required
To make your own diy m&m costume, you’ll need the following materials:
- 2 yards of felt in your desired M&M color (enough for a max 36″ diameter costume)
- Iron-on transfer paper for dark fabrics
- Solid-colored shirt or dress (any color works)
- Scissors
- Iron
How to Make It
Creating the m&m candy costume is a quick and easy process that can be completed in about 30 minutes.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
- Cut out a large circular shape from the felt, approximately 36″ in diameter, to create the main body of the costume.
- Use the iron-on transfer paper to create the iconic “m” logo. Cut out the lowercase “m” shape and iron it onto the center of the felt circle.
- Wear a solid-colored shirt or dress as the base of the costume, then attach the felt circle over the top, securing it with safety pins or fabric glue.
The diy m&m costume can be easily adapted for different age groups, from toddlers to adults. For a more comfortable fit, consider creating a peanut M&M costume with the felt circle attached to a shirt or dress that allows for arm movement.

Rainy Day Costume
For those who love the whimsical charm of rainy weather, a rainy day costume is a delightful DIY option. This creative ensemble brings the joy of a downpour right to your Halloween festivities. To craft this costume, you’ll need a raincoat and boots, an umbrella, and some synthetic pillow stuffing to create the perfect rain cloud accents.
Start by attaching the pillow stuffing to the umbrella to mimic the fluffy, cumulus shape of a rain cloud. Use a bit of hot glue or spray adhesive to secure the stuffing in place. Next, cut out blue construction paper “raindrops” and suspend them from the umbrella using yarn or fishing line. This touch adds a playful, dripping effect to the ensemble.
To complete the look, don your raincoat and boots, and you’re ready to brave the storm in style! Bubble Bath Costume
For a delightfully bubbly DIY Halloween costume, consider creating a bubble bath costume. This charming and easy-to-make option is perfect for kids and adults alike, allowing you to transform into a literal bath time scene. With just a few simple supplies, you can become the star of the spooky season in this whimsical getup.
Items Needed
- White top and bottoms
- White balloons
- Safety pins
- Sponge or scrub brush
- Rubber duck
Assembly Steps
To create the diy bubble bath costume, start by inflating the white balloons. Carefully use the safety pins to attach the balloons to your white clothing, arranging them to mimic the look of a bubbly bubble bath. Add a sponge or scrub brush as an accessory, and don’t forget the finishing touch – a playful rubber duck! With these simple steps, you’ll be transformed into a walking, talking bubble bath in no time.
